Two hamburgers and three cokes cost $10.50. Four hamburgers and four cokes cost $18.00. Find the cost of a hamburger and a coke.

Answers

Answer: hamburger $3.00

Coke $1.50

Step-by-step explanation:

2hamburgers & 3cokes= $10.50

4hamburgers & 4cokes= $18.00

Let hamburger represent H

And coke represent C

2H +3C= 10.50.......equation 1

4H+4C= 18.00.......equation 2

2H =10.50 -3C...........equation 3

The 4H can be rewriting as

2(2H) right

So substitute for the 4H

So we have,

2(2H) +4C= 18

Substitute for 2H

2(10.50 -3C) +4C =18

Open the bracket

21 -6C +4C= 18

21-2C= 18

-2C = 18-21

-2C = -3

Minus cancel minus

C= 3/2 = $1.5

Substitute for c in equation 1

2H+3C =10.50

2H+3(1.5)= 10.50

2H+4.5=10.5

2H= 10.5-4.5

2H =6

H= 6/2

H=$3

So

An hamburger cost $3.00

A coke cost $1.50

Find the volume of a pyramid with a square base, where the side length of the base is
8.3 in and the height of the pyramid is 7.3 in. Round your answer to the nearest
tenth of a cubic inch.

Answers

The volume of the pyramid is  167.6 cube inch (approx).

Step-by-step explanation:

Given,

Each length (l) of the base of the pyramid = 8.3 in

Height(h) of the pyramid = 7.3 in

To find the volume of the pyramid.

Formula

Volume of the pyramid = [tex]\frac{1}{3}[/tex]×area of the base×height

Area of the base = l²

Now,

The volume of the pyramid =  [tex]\frac{1}{3}[/tex]×l²×h

=  [tex]\frac{1}{3}[/tex]×8.3²×7.3 cube inch = 167.6 cube inch (approx)

Final answer:

The volume of the pyramid is calculated using the formula for a pyramid's volume, V = (1/3)bh, with a base area of 68.89 in² and height of 7.3 in, which gives a volume of approximately 167.5 in³.

Explanation:

To find the volume of a pyramid with a square base, we can use the formula V = (1/3)bh, where b is the area of the base and h is the height of the pyramid. First, calculate the area of the square base by squaring the side length: b = s² = 8.3 in × 8.3 in = 68.89 in². Next, use this base area in the formula to get the volume: V = (1/3) × 68.89 in² × 7.3 in.

Doing the calculation, we find that V = (1/3) × 68.89 in² × 7.3 in = 167.4757 in³. To round to the nearest tenth, the volume of the pyramid is approximately 167.5 in³.

A ranch experienced growth of its gopher population at a 1.5% annual rate, compounded continuously. At the end of a 3 year period, the population had reached a size of 78 gophers. How many gophers were on the ranch at the beginning of the 3 years according to the exponential growth function? Round your answer up to the nearest whole number, and do not include units.

Answers

Answer:

75 gophers (about)

Step-by-step explanation:

We will use continuous compounding interest formula:

[tex]P(t)=P_0e^{rt}[/tex]

Where

P(t) is final value (at time t)

P_0 is initial value

r is the compounding rate

t is the time period

Given:

P(t) = 78

r is 1.5% or 1.5/100 = 0.015

t is 3

We solve for P_0, what we want, using algebra as shown below:

[tex]P(t)=P_0e^{rt}\\78=P_0e^{(0.015)(3)}\\78=P_0e^{0.045}\\\frac{78}{P_0}=e^{0.045}\\\frac{78}{P_0}=1.0460\\P_0=74.57[/tex]

So, the initial population was 75 gophers.

The 75 gophers were on the ranch at the beginning of the 3 years according to the exponential growth function.

To solve this problem, we can use the following exponential growth function:

P(t) = P_0 * e^(rt)

where:

P(t) is the population at time t

P_0 is the initial population

r is the annual growth rate

t is the time in years

We know that the population after 3 years is 78 gophers, and the annual growth rate is 1.5%. We want to find the initial population, P_0.

So, we can plug in the following values into the exponential growth function:

P(3) = 78 = P_0 * e^(0.015 * 3)

Dividing both sides by e^(0.015 * 3), we get:

P_0 = 78 / e^(0.015 * 3)

Using a calculator, we can evaluate P_0 to be approximately 75.0.

Rounding up to the nearest whole number, we get an initial population of 75 gophers.

A town has a population of 17000 and grows at 3% every year. To the nearest year, how long will it be until the population will reach 20400

Answers

Answer:

The population will reach 20,400 after 6 years.

Step-by-step explanation:

Exponential function:

[tex]y(t)=y_0(1+r)^t[/tex]

y(t)= Population after t years

[tex]y_0[/tex] = initial population

r= rate of grow

t= time.

A town has a population of 17,000 and grows at a rate 3% every year.

y(t)= 20,400, [tex]y_0[/tex] = 17,000, r=3%=0.03, t=?

[tex]20,400=17,000(1+0.03)^t[/tex]

[tex]\Rightarrow \frac{20,400}{17,000}=(1.03)^t[/tex]

[tex]\Rightarrow \frac{102}{85}=(1.03)^t[/tex]

Taking ln function both sides

[tex]\Rightarrow ln|\frac{102}{85}|=ln|(1.03)^t|[/tex]

[tex]\Rightarrow ln|\frac{102}{85}|=t\ ln|(1.03)|[/tex]

[tex]\Rightarrow t=\frac{ln|\frac{102}{85}|}{\ ln|(1.03)|}[/tex]

⇒ t = 6 year.

The population will reach 20,400 after 6 years.
